About This Equipment

The KOMATSU WA200-6 High Lift Rubber-Tired Loader is a versatile and powerful machine designed for maximum efficiency on construction sites. With a high lift feature that allows for easy loading and unloading of materials, this loader boasts a spacious cab with ergonomic controls for operator comfort and productivity. Equipped with a Tier 3 engine for reduced emissions and improved fuel efficiency, the WA200-6 also features a hydrostatic transmission for smooth operation and precise control. Its durable rubber tires provide excellent traction on various terrains, making it ideal for a wide range of applications. Whether tackling heavy-duty tasks or handling light materials, the KOMATSU WA200-6 High Lift Rubber-Tired Loader delivers exceptional performance and reliability, making it a top choice for construction professionals worldwide.
